The ingredients needed to make Sautéd Potatoes and Roasted Chicken Breast:
  1. Take 6 Boneless Skinless Chicken Breast
  2. Make ready 2 Gold Potatoes
  3. Make ready 1 Diced Carrot
  4. Take 1 1/2 Diced Onion
  5. Make ready 1 Salt
  6. Make ready 1 Pepper
  7. Prepare 1 olive oil, extra virgin
Steps to make Sautéd Potatoes and Roasted Chicken Breast:
  1. Take a whole onion and dice half.
  2. Cut carrots into small dices.
  3. Skin your Potatoes
  4. Cut potatoes into nice even size cubes.
  5. Place chicken breast, best side up on a roasting pan.
  6. Sprinkle a little salt and pepper on top of each piece.
  7. Roast in preheated 400°F oven at 15 minutes per Chicken Breast pound.
  8. Baste every 15 minutes with olive oil.
  9. Chicken breast is done when internal temperature is exactly 165 degrees!
  10. Place saute pan over medium high heat with little olive oil for fat.
  11. Saute potatoes until tender.
  12. Salt and pepper them at the end.
  13. Experiment with different seasonings to meet your liking, but the key thing to remember is not to over cook your chicken while trying not to under cook them. If your calibrated thermometer reads 165 exact, it will be done, tender, and juicy 100% of the time!
